管理工具欄 - 必備的 Drupal 模塊

已發表: 2023-06-06

等等……先聽我們說完 - 想像這樣一個場景,您需要深入了解您的傳統衣櫥,找到一件適合特殊場合穿的裙子。 圖片怎麼樣? 累嗎?

現在想像一個步入式衣櫥,您可以在其中快速瀏覽所有服裝,並為那個特殊場合親手挑選您最喜歡的一件。

後者可以節省您的時間並讓您快速訪問各種選項。 Drupal 管理工具欄模塊為網站管理員做同樣的事情。 它使您的工作變得輕鬆快捷,讓您輕鬆到達目的地,並為您節省大量時間來瀏覽您網站上的選項。

在此博客中,您將了解管理工具欄模塊的好處和用途。 您可能已經在使用它,但如果沒有,您將在閱讀此博客後使用它。 即使您是,也請務必閱讀它,因為我們還將討論有關此模塊的一些鮮為人知的事實。

什麼是管理工具欄模塊?

在數字時代,期望通過更少的人力努力使事情變得越來越容易已經成為常態。 這個模塊也是這種易於審核的一個例子。

管理工具欄模塊是對標准或默認工具欄的升級,即站點頂部的管理菜單。 使用該模塊,您可以使用下拉菜單授權常規工具欄并快速訪問所有管理頁面。

這是一個輕型模塊,可以覆蓋您的默認工具欄核心模塊。 它採用響應式快捷方式並保持默認工具欄功能處於活動狀態。

Drupal 管理工具欄模塊的一些事實和使用統計

您知道 Drupal 管理工具欄模塊於 2015 年 4 月 20 日發布嗎? 隨著時間的推移,它的使用量一直在持續增長。 現在,超過280,000個網站使用了這個模塊。

管理員

資料來源: Drupal.org

雖然這個模塊還不在 Drupal 核心中,但添加到其中可能是一個很棒的功能。 這樣,它可以進一步提高開箱即用的可用性。

版本狀態和子模塊

該模塊的 3.x 版有一個配置表單,因此站點管理員可以限制要在下拉菜單中顯示的捆綁包庫存。

此外,您可以使用以下附帶的子模塊:

Admin Toolbar Extra Tools:使用這個子模塊,您可以添加一些菜單項,如 Cache Rebuild、Run Cron、Index site 等,這些都是經常使用的管理任務。

管理工具欄搜索:您需要此模塊來授權搜索框查找管理頁面。

管理工具欄鏈接訪問過濾器:使用此子模塊,您可以過濾掉用戶不應訪問的鏈接。 確保使用路由名稱而不是自定義菜單鏈接的內部路徑。

管理工具欄模塊的好處

不僅僅是這個模塊的配置表單,Drupal 有一個包含各種配置表單的綜合系統。 大多數這些配置表單是嵌套的,因此用戶可以從父選項卡訪問它們。

默認工具欄無法引導您到達目的地,因為管理菜單並不寬泛。 它確實佔用了一個人的時間來訪問各種網站以進行一項特定的操作。 在前面的場景中(在啟動此模塊之前) ,您必須單擊“內容類型” ,然後單擊“文章”才能添加文章。

多虧了這個模塊,您現在可以通過具有響應性、擴展功能的下拉列表節省大量時間。 此外,您可以限制用戶訪問我們網站上的某些鏈接。 為此,您有 Admin Toolbar Access Filter,這是前面提到的一個子模塊。

如何安裝管理工具欄模塊?

讓我們先從下載管理工具欄模塊開始。

1. 運行這個 Composer 命令:

作曲家需要 drupal/admin_toolbar

2.訪問Extend頁面並點擊Extend

或訪問:https://<yourDrupalSite.dev/admin/modules

3.在搜索框中搜索“管理工具欄”

4. 選中管理工具欄的複選框

5.安裝Admin Toolbar模塊及其三個子模塊

擴展管理工具欄

工具欄的功能取決於所有四個模塊的協作。

管理工具欄模塊及其 3 個子模塊

以下是通過協作創建最佳輸出的所有四個模塊的細分:

管理工具欄

它是基本模塊,安裝後在標準工具欄上提供下拉功能。

基本站點設置

資料來源: Drupal.org

如前所述,模塊的 3.0.0 版本引入了一種新的配置形式,這可能會產生性能問題。 要配置此問題,請轉到:

管理 > 配置 > 用戶界面 > 管理工具欄工具

請務必仔細查看“加載大量項目可能導致性能問題”的警告。

管理工具欄額外工具

Admin Toolbar Extra Tools 是三個子模塊之一,可讓您通過以下功能添加額外的下拉功能:

  • 下拉功能中的其他菜單選項
  • 管理工具欄左上角的 Drupal 徽標
  • 按字母順序索引的功能列表
  • 刷新單個或所有緩存
  • 無需等待 3 小時,而是立即運行 cron 作業
  • 發布模塊更新,運行系統更新
  • 使用快速訪問註銷功能

管理工具欄鏈接訪問過濾器

站點管理員可以限制用戶訪問特定鏈接。 這些用戶將擁有“使用管理頁面和幫助”權限,但無法訪問網站上的某些頁面。 但是,此類用戶仍然可以查看菜單項。 該子模塊只需安裝即可使用,不需要任何配置。

管理工具欄搜索

您會在管理工具欄本身上找到管理工具欄搜索框。 剛接觸 Drupal 的初學者、站點構建者或管理員可以使用此搜索框來查找功能或管理和配置頁面。

互補模塊

這些是一些子模塊,用於將櫻桃配料添加到您使用管理工具欄模塊製作的蛋糕中 -

  • 工具欄菜單:添加可與管理工具欄輕鬆融合的任何菜單,使它們易於訪問下拉菜單。
  • 工具欄防閃爍:消除工具欄子菜單對網站頁面其餘部分的影響。
  • Coffee:使用此模塊查找管理路徑。
  • Adminimal 管理工具欄:向您的頁面添加黑色主題。
  • 管理工具欄內容語言:添加鏈接以使用任何活動語言創建內容。
  • 工具欄主題:從這裡訪問很棒的 UI 主題。

最後的想法

如果您想要一份網站必備的 Drupal 模塊列表,Admin Toolbar 模塊就是一個包含在該列表中的模塊。 站點管理員和構建者可以輕鬆管理內容並配置和開發更好的用戶體驗。

參考:

  • https://www.droptica.com/blog/how-manage-backend-website-drupal-admin-toolbar-module/
  • https://www.volacci.com/drupal-seo-guide/drupal-admin-toolbar-module
  • https://www.webwash.net/quick-search-and-drop-downs-to-toolbar-using-admin-toolbar-in-drupal/
  • https://www.drupal.org/project/admin_toolbar